Simple answer...wear and tear on the starter, battery, and ignition systems. It also will turn off the A/C while it’s stopped at a light. It saves droplets of fuel per tank. Easier to turn it off and leave it off through FORScan than have to replace the starter and battery. Good points.I did the plug in module from 4DTech.
as for why I hate the start/stop...because it’s not very smooth and in my case I felt it could help cause a minor accident. Like when I’m pulling into my garage if I were to pull in just a touch short of where I want and cause the engine to quit, when I lift my foot back up the vehicle could lurch forward more than I would like, and cause me to run into the storage racks I have in front of it. That extra lurch isn’t a problem when driving, when when inches matter it’s more trouble than helpful.
plus I didn’t buy the biggest vehicle on the market I could because I wanted good gas mileage.
